4,500+ servers built on MCP Fusion
Vinkius

Dutchie Plus MCP. Manage locations, menus, and orders from one chat.

Claude Claude
ChatGPT ChatGPT
Cursor Cursor
Gemini Gemini
Windsurf Windsurf
VS Code VS Code
JetBrains JetBrains
Vercel Vercel
See Vinkius in Action

Works with every AI agent you already use

…and any MCP-compatible client

Dutchie Plus MCP on Cursor AI Code Editor MCP Client Dutchie Plus MCP on Claude Desktop App MCP Integration Dutchie Plus MCP on OpenAI Agents SDK MCP Compatible Dutchie Plus MCP on Visual Studio Code MCP Extension Client Dutchie Plus MCP on GitHub Copilot AI Agent MCP Integration Dutchie Plus MCP on Google Gemini AI MCP Integration Dutchie Plus MCP on Lovable AI Development MCP Client Dutchie Plus MCP on Mistral AI Agents MCP Compatible Dutchie Plus MCP on Amazon AWS Bedrock MCP Support

Just plug in your AI agents and start using Vinkius.

Dutchie Plus MCP Server gives your AI agent control over multi-location dispensary operations. It lets you track online menus, monitor enterprise-wide orders, and manage location details from a single chat interface.

Use it to audit product brands and check order fulfillment status across your entire network.

What your AI agents can do

Get dutchie plus metadata

Checks your Dutchie Plus account limits and metadata.

Get location details

Gets specific configuration and information for one dispensary location.

Get order details

Retrieves all detailed information for a single online order.

+ 7 more capabilities included
Audit Location Status

Retrieves detailed settings and real-time information for a specific dispensary location using get_location_details.

Search Dispensaries by Keyword

Finds dispensary locations by searching using a city or name keyword via search_dispensaries_by_city.

List All Locations

Retrieves a full list of all dispensary locations managed in your Dutchie Plus account using list_dispensary_locations.

Check Online Menus

Lists all active online menus configured for a specific dispensary location using list_online_menus.

Track Enterprise Orders

Retrieves and lists recent online orders for a specific dispensary location using list_enterprise_orders.

Identify Pending Orders

Finds online orders that are waiting to be fulfilled or are ready for pickup via list_pending_fulfillment_orders.

Inventory Brand Audit

Lists all product brands synchronized across your entire enterprise account using list_synced_brands.

Supported MCP Clients

Claude Claude
ChatGPT ChatGPT
Cursor Cursor
Gemini Gemini
Windsurf Windsurf
VS Code VS Code
JetBrains JetBrains
Vercel Vercel
+ other MCP clients
Free for Subscribers

Waiting for input…

AI Agent

get019d758a

get dutchie plus metadata

Checks your Dutchie Plus account limits and metadata.

get019d758a

get location details

Gets specific configuration and information for one dispensary location.

get019d758a

get order details

Retrieves all detailed information for a single online order.

list019d758a

list dispensary locations

Lists every dispensary location managed in your account.

list019d758a

list enterprise orders

Lists all recent online orders for a specific dispensary location.

list019d758a

list online menus

Lists all configured online menus for a specific location.

list019d758a

list pending fulfillment orders

Finds online orders that are awaiting fulfillment or are ready for pickup.

list019d758a

list synced brands

Lists all product brands synchronized across your enterprise account.

quick019d758a

quick enterprise volume audit

Provides a high-level summary of order activity across multiple locations.

search019d758a

search dispensaries by city

Searches for dispensary locations using a city or name keyword.

Choose How to Get Started

Build a custom MCP for your own tools, or connect a ready-made integration from our catalog.

Build Your Own

Turn any API into an MCP. Import a spec, define Agent Skills, or deploy with MCPFusion.

  • Import from OpenAPI, Swagger, or YAML specs
  • Create Agent Skills with progressive disclosure
  • Deploy to edge with MCPFusion framework
  • Built in DLP, auth, and compliance on every call
  • Real time usage dashboard and cost metering
  • Publish to catalog or keep private
Start building

Make Your AI Do More

Start with Dutchie Plus, then connect any of our 4,700+ other servers whenever your AI needs more. One click, no limits.

  • Use this MCP plus 4,700+ others, all in one place
  • Add new capabilities to your AI anytime you want
  • Every connection is secured and compliant automatically
  • Track usage and costs across all your servers
  • Works with Claude, ChatGPT, Cursor, and more
  • New servers added to the catalog every week

What you can do with this MCP connector

Dutchie Plus MCP Server gives your AI agent control over multi-location dispensary operations. You can track online menus, monitor enterprise-wide orders, and manage location details from one chat window. You use natural language to manage your whole operation.

Audit Location Status: You can get detailed settings and real-time info for one specific dispensary location using get_location_details. You can also search for locations by city or name using search_dispensaries_by_city, or grab a full list of every managed location with list_dispensary_locations.

Check Online Menus: You can list all active online menus set up for a specific location with list_online_menus.

Order Tracking: You can pull all detailed info for a single online order using get_order_details. You can list recent online orders for a specific location with list_enterprise_orders, and find orders that are waiting to be fulfilled or are ready for pickup via list_pending_fulfillment_orders.

Brand Audits: You can list all product brands synced across your whole enterprise account using list_synced_brands. You can also run a high-level summary of order activity across multiple sites with quick_enterprise_volume_audit.

Metadata: You can check your Dutchie Plus account limits and metadata with get_dutchie_plus_metadata.

How Dutchie Plus MCP Works

  1. 1 Connect the Dutchie Plus integration to your AI client and authorize it with your API key.
  2. 2 Ask your agent a question, like 'What are the pending orders for Downtown Dispensary?'
  3. 3 The agent calls list_pending_fulfillment_orders and get_location_details to give you the answer.

The bottom line is that your agent handles all the complex API calls, letting you manage multi-location retail tasks through simple conversation.

Who Is Dutchie Plus MCP For?

This is for operations leaders and enterprise managers who need a single pane of glass view across multiple dispensary locations. If you spend your day jumping between inventory dashboards, order fulfillment systems, and location status pages, this saves you hours of clicks. It lets you audit the entire business from one chat window.

Operations Manager

Checks order volumes and location activity across the entire fleet on the go. Audits menu availability and category mapping via chat.

Inventory Lead

Audits synchronized brands and location-specific order details instantly. Verifies product counts across different sites.

Digital Merchandiser

Monitors online menu availability and product category mapping across all enterprise locations.

What Changes When You Connect

  • See the full scope of your network instantly. Instead of manually checking dashboards, use list_dispensary_locations or search_dispensaries_by_city to list and find any location by name or city.
  • Keep track of sales and inventory across the board. list_synced_brands gives you a list of all product brands in your enterprise account, showing how many associated products each brand has.
  • Monitor fulfillment status instantly. Use list_pending_fulfillment_orders to pull a list of all orders that are ready for pickup or waiting to be fulfilled.
  • Get specific details on any order. If you need to know exactly what's wrong with a single sale, call get_order_details to get the full history and status for that order.
  • Check local menus without logging in. list_online_menus accesses and lists all configured online menus for a specific location, pulling the current category mapping.
  • Audit the whole business with one command. quick_enterprise_volume_audit gives you a high-level summary of order activity across multiple locations, saving you from writing complex reports.

Real-World Use Cases

01

Checking out a new location

A new manager needs to audit a potential site. They ask their agent to search_dispensaries_by_city for 'Austin'. The agent returns a list of matching locations, and the manager can then ask for get_location_details on the specific site to see if it's ready to go.

02

Investigating order delays

A customer calls about a late order. Instead of manually pulling up the order ID in three different systems, the agent uses get_order_details and list_enterprise_orders to pull the full fulfillment history and payment status immediately.

03

Seasonal menu updates

The merchandising team needs to verify that the new holiday menu is live everywhere. They ask the agent to list_online_menus for all target locations and cross-reference the resulting menu URLs.

04

Brand audit for compliance

The compliance officer needs to confirm which brands are synchronized across the network. They run list_synced_brands, which immediately returns the list of brands and the product count associated with each one.

The Tradeoffs

Mixing up location names

The user manually tries to remember the exact internal ID for a location, leading to failed API calls because the ID changes or is hard to find.

Use list_dispensary_locations first. This tool lists all managed locations, giving you the correct IDs and names to use for subsequent calls like list_online_menus or get_location_details.

Ignoring fulfillment status

The user only checks list_enterprise_orders and sees an order, but doesn't know if it's paid, ready for pickup, or waiting on inventory, leading to inaccurate status updates.

Always run list_pending_fulfillment_orders after checking orders. This tool specifically identifies orders that are waiting for action, giving you the true operational status.

Running audits without scope

The user asks for 'all sales' without specifying a location or time frame, resulting in an unusable, massive data dump that takes forever to process.

Start by running quick_enterprise_volume_audit to get a high-level summary. If you need deep data, use list_dispensary_locations to define the scope first.

When It Fits, When It Doesn't

Use this if your job requires real-time oversight of multi-site operations, where order, inventory, and location data must be correlated. You need to know not just what happened, but where it happened and when it was fulfilled. Don't use this if you only need to check one specific, isolated piece of data—for example, if you just need to know the total number of products in one single brand. In that case, a simple product catalog API might be enough. However, if you need to list the location and the order status and the menu status, Dutchie Plus is necessary.

Independent Platform Disclaimer: Vinkius is an independent platform and is not affiliated with, endorsed by, sponsored by, verified by, or otherwise authorized by Dutchie Plus. All third-party trademarks, logos, and brand names are the property of their respective owners. Their use on this website is strictly for informational purposes to identify service compatibility and interoperability.

VINKIUS INFRASTRUCTURE

Cloud Hosted

Managed infra

V8 Isolated

Sandboxed per request

Zero-Trust Proxy

No stored credentials

DLP Enforced

Policy on every call

GDPR Compliant

EU data residency

Token Compression

~60% cost reduction

How we secure it →

Works with Claude, ChatGPT, Cursor, and more

The Model Context Protocol standardizes how applications expose capabilities to LLMs. Instead of operating in isolation, your AI gains direct access to external platforms, live data, and real-world actions through secure, standardized connections.

This server provides 10 capabilities that interface natively with Claude, ChatGPT, Cursor, and any MCP client. No middleware. No custom integration required.

Available Capabilities

get_dutchie_plus_metadata get_location_details get_order_details list_dispensary_locations list_enterprise_orders list_online_menus list_pending_fulfillment_orders list_synced_brands quick_enterprise_volume_audit search_dispensaries_by_city

Managing multi-site retail data shouldn't require 10 different dashboards.

Today, checking a handful of locations means logging into the main dashboard, then navigating to the menu tab, then switching to the orders tab. You copy the location ID, paste it into the menu tool, then copy the ID again to the order tool. It's a miserable loop of copy-pasting IDs and switching tabs.

With the Dutchie Plus MCP Server, you just ask your agent, 'Show me the online menu and pending orders for the Downtown dispensary.' The agent handles the complex calls to `list_online_menus` and `list_pending_fulfillment_orders` in the background. You get the full data summary, no manual steps required.

Dutchie Plus MCP Server: Audit location and order status

You currently have to call separate systems just to list all your locations and then call a second system to see what's happening in the orders. This means you are always dealing with disjointed lists that don't tell the full story.

Now, your agent combines the data from `list_dispensary_locations` and `quick_enterprise_volume_audit`. You get a single, actionable report showing the location status alongside the overall order activity. The data flows seamlessly.

Common Questions About Dutchie Plus MCP

How do I use `list_dispensary_locations` with Dutchie Plus? +

The list_dispensary_locations tool gives you a list of every location managed in your account. It's the first step if you need to know which sites are even connected to the system.

Can I check all pending orders using `list_pending_fulfillment_orders`? +

Yes, list_pending_fulfillment_orders identifies all orders awaiting fulfillment or ready for pickup across the relevant scope you provide. This is better than just checking general order lists.

How does `list_synced_brands` help with inventory? +

list_synced_brands lists all product brands in your enterprise account and tells you how many associated products are linked to each brand. It's a quick way to audit your catalog size.

What is the difference between `list_enterprise_orders` and `list_pending_fulfillment_orders`? +

list_enterprise_orders lists all recent orders for a site. list_pending_fulfillment_orders narrows that down to only those orders that are currently stuck in the fulfillment process or ready for pickup.

How do I use `get_location_details` to check a specific dispensary's configuration? +

You provide the location ID to get_location_details. This returns the detailed settings, operational status, and specific configuration data for that single dispensary location. You can use this to verify things like hours of operation or local compliance flags.

What kind of data can I get using `list_online_menus` for a specific location? +

The list_online_menus tool retrieves all configured online menus for a given location. It provides the menu names, category structures, and the corresponding preview URLs, letting you map out the digital product offering.

How do I audit my entire network using `quick_enterprise_volume_audit`? +

This tool provides a high-level summary of order activity across multiple locations. It aggregates key metrics, giving you a quick snapshot of total order volume or overall activity without needing to check every location individually.

Can I find a location using the `search_dispensaries_by_city` tool? +

Yes, you input a city name or a partial location name into search_dispensaries_by_city. The tool returns a list of matching dispensary locations, allowing you to quickly narrow down your focus across a large network.

How do I get a Dutchie Plus API Key? +

Log in to your Dutchie Plus enterprise dashboard, navigate to the API or Integrations section in your enterprise settings, and you can generate your unique API Key from there.

Can the agent manage inventory levels? +

Dutchie Plus primarily manages the online e-commerce layer. Inventory levels are typically managed in the underlying POS (like Dutchie POS). This integration focuses on menus and online orders.

Does it support multi-location reporting? +

Yes, you can use the list_dispensary_locations tool to see all sites and then query orders or menus for any specific location in your network.

More in this category

You might also like

Built & Managed by Vinkius 30s setup 10 tools

We've already built the connector for Dutchie Plus. Just plug in your AI agents and start using Vinkius.

No hosting. No infrastructure. No complex setup.
All 10 tools are live and waiting. You're up and running in seconds.

Claude Claude
ChatGPT ChatGPT
Cursor Cursor
Gemini Gemini
Windsurf Windsurf
VS Code VS Code
JetBrains JetBrains
Vercel Vercel
+ other MCP clients

Vinkius gives your AI agents access to the full catalog of app connectors, all fully managed, secure, and enterprise-ready. One subscription, every tool you need.

Zero hosting required Full MCP catalog included Enterprise-grade security Auto-updated by Vinkius

Built, hosted, and secured by Vinkius. You just connect and go.